36+ Acres- Beautiful parcel. Ag exempt unrestricted acres off of a private road with beautiful hardwoods, large oak trees, the large tree's surrounding the property provide a lovely canopy of shade, and has one pond. Great for cattle or horses. Has one road easement up front for the next door neighbor but doesn't interfere with the main gate or the property. Has tremendous wildlife on the place with deer & hogs that roam the property, power and electricity is close by.
